Stitch Fix Inc. had its best trading day on Friday since the company went public, closing up 26% to $24.87 during the regular session after posting strong first-quarter earnings after the bell Thursday. Stitch Fix shares were up a fraction during the after hours session. The company beat top- and bottom-line expectations Thursday, logging net income of $9.5 million on sales of $316.7 million, well above analyst expectations, according to FactSet. The company also announced a line of kids apparel. Stitch Fix stock has gained 67% since its November IPO, as the benchmark S&P 500 index rose 7.4%.
